the same applies to most professional endeavors, e.g., engineers. you really, really, want to make sure the guy designing the bridge had reference material handy before he signed off on it! however, i also agree that there is a huge difference between being able to look up a "solution," and formulate one on your own. in the case of an engineering exam, you would expect that all the necessary parameters, i.e., the stuff you would otherwise look up in reference material, were provided in the question, and it is the onus of the exam taker to have the requisite knowledge to solve the problem from there. in other words, the test should be more about his problem solving skills rather than his memorization skills. i would suspect that different professions have different weighting between these two major skill sets making the distinction at exam time much more ambiguous. taks
